Dr. Jill Henning, Professor of Biology at University of Pittsburgh at Johnstown, is the head of four UPJ professors who secured $115,000 in funding to develop a substance to help prevent lyme disease.
Dr. Henning also recently received the 2023 Graduate School of Public Health for Pitt Alumni award for her work with COVID vaccination in rural counties..
She talks about both with us on today's Bo and Moore PA Podcast
